Transaction 77c15981536710889afc48c78cd585647812007c446d5b32b0c35b1152412528
1 Input
1 Output
-
77c15981536710889afc48c78cd585647812007c446d5b32b0c35b1152412528:0
- value
- 307962
- script pubkey
- OP_0 OP_PUSHBYTES_20 16eb6438f37b053071cbe30881f9a921d4b784ce
- address
- bc1qzm4kgw8n0vznquwtuvygr7dfy82t0pxwlxjjxp